Preparing the Morgan Hill Home for Peace



Morgan Hill has actually constantly supplied a fantastic, kicked back way of life, and a number of our homes, snuggled in peaceful neighborhoods or near the vineyards, give adequate space for organizing. When an enjoyed one has memory obstacles, however, this experience can swiftly come to be frustrating when cluttered with designs. Bright, strobe lights, intricate figurines, and the fragrance of unknown mixture all contribute to a sensory overload that can promptly cause agitation or confusion.



Maintain the decors simple, concentrating just on a few significant items that bring a rich history. For instance, instead of having a big, fully decorated Christmas tree, display a smaller sized one with just a few ornaments your enjoyed one made or constantly loved. Choose soft, consistent white lights over blinking color. Think of the physical flow of your home, also. You need to ensure pathways stay clear, particularly in the evening when the reduced daytime hours indicate hallways and areas come to be darker faster. Sundowning, the typical rise in confusion and frustration throughout the late afternoon and evening, is a genuine variable. Preparation activities for earlier in the day works far better than waiting till after sundown. If you have prompt family taking a trip from the greater Bay Area, possibly from Gilroy and even as much north as San Jose, think about inquiring to get here early so your loved one can enjoy their company prior to the evening's change in power and light begins.



You must always designate a "safe space," which is a quiet, comfortable area-- possibly a cozy den or a seldom-used guest bed room-- where your liked one can pull back if the turmoil ends up being excessive. This room needs to have familiar items, like a favorite covering or a calming CD of classical music, to aid ground them. Leading Guests Through a New Reality



Family members that do not check out regularly typically battle the most with changes in communication and behavior. They remember your loved one as they were, and they may not recognize how dramatically dementia affects discussion, routine, and sensory handling. You do an excellent service by connecting clear guidelines to all guests prior to they get here. Do this with a kind email or even a short telephone call. Clarify that simplicity is vital which suggesting, fixing, or testing memory is detrimental and disturbing for everybody included.



Give your visitors concrete, workable suggestions. Tell them to speak gradually, make use of simple sentences, keep cozy eye contact, and never ever ask flexible concerns like, "Do you remember me?" Rather, recommend they make a declarative statement followed by a basic action, such as, "Hello, Dad, I'm Michael, your child. Come rest below alongside me." Clarify that your enjoyed one might duplicate themselves usually, and motivate visitors to listen and respond with persistence, concentrating on the emotion behind the words instead of the accurate details. Remember, even if your loved one neglects what someone stated two minutes ago, they always remember exactly how that individual made them really feel. A warm, comforting tone produces a favorable memory link that lasts much longer than any kind of factual conversation.



Involving the individual with dementia in the prep work is just one of the most efficient ways to make them feel valuable and included. This is not about complex jobs however easy, familiar functions. Possibly they can fold paper napkins, assistance type silverware, or take part in mixing a straightforward, non-messy batter. For individuals that deal with memory loss, taking part in tasks that use acquainted, long-lasting abilities brings a profound sense of self-regard. Finding Comfort in Local Rhythms and Routines



One significant difficulty during the vacations is the disturbance of a person's normal regimen. Morgan Hill is an "Age-Friendly City," indicating its facilities and community are made to sustain older adults. This concentrate on stability and accessibility need to reach your holiday strategies. Your liked one thrives on uniformity-- meal times, medicine timetables, and sleep patterns should continue to be as stable as feasible, despite guests in the house.



Our beautiful, moderate, Mediterranean climate indicates you can frequently incorporate gentle exterior task, which helps in reducing frustration. If the mid-day is clear, a brief, supervised stroll outside to appreciate the silent winter season greenery or merely feel the cool, fresh air is a superb way to redirect anxiety. If it is just one of those commonly wetter South Bay days, a sensory activity inside your home works equally as well. Place on some favored songs from their youth, carefully scrub scented lotion on their hands, or provide a straightforward craft activity. These familiar, nonverbal interactions provide comfort and bypass the anxiety of spoken interaction.
